Abstract


Weeds were plants whose presence was undesirable because it lowered the yield of agricultural land that could be achieved by the production plant. Weeding the groundnut crop had been done conventionally, weeding method had many drawbacks. The purpose of this research was to design, fabricate and per-formance test of the weed clean device on peanut plants. The results showed that the dimensions of the weed clean device was 1332 mm long, connecting rods were made of pipe with a diameter of I inch, wide handlebars 732 mm diameter, wheel steering handlebars handheld was 48 mm, wheelbase was 150 mm steel, blade was made of steel plate 2 mm with a length of 250 mm and a width of 20 mm. The strength and durability of the weed clean device were met because the stress permis (131 MPa) was greater than the stress occurred (16.9 Mpa). From the obtained performance test of weed clean device capacity was 16 hours /ha, better than weeding manually, 90 hours /ha.
